Policy - Federal Level

Energy Policy Act of 2005

The first time since 1992 that the federal government revisited national energy policy. The Energy Policy Act of 2005 included an extension of the Production Tax Credit (PTC) through the end of 007, the creation of Clean Renewable Energy Bonds, and many other provisions.

Energy Policy Act of 1992 (NEPA)

A federal statute that, among other things, established additional forms of non-utility generators. It also permitted non-generator-owning municipalities to purchase wholesale electricity, thus opening the door to municipalization, which allows municipal governments to take control over providing electric service to electric consumers.

Perspectives on an NWCC/NREL Assessment of Distributed Wind

This 2000 report out of the National Renewable Energy Laboratory reviews an assessment of distributed wind generation and it's associated business, policy and technical issues, and includes action steps for facilitating the growth of distributed wind.
